legongju.com
我们一直在努力
2025-01-15 06:30 | 星期三

Linux的write操作权限继承机制

Linux文件系统的权限管理是基于用户、组和其他用户的。每个文件和目录都有一个所有者(user)和一个所属组(group)。权限分为三类:读(r)、写(w)和执行(x)。

在Linux中,当一个用户对一个文件或目录进行写操作时,需要检查该用户是否具有相应的权限。如果用户是文件或目录的所有者,那么他具有写权限。如果用户属于文件或目录所属的组,并且该组具有写权限,那么用户也具有写权限。最后,如果其他用户具有写权限,那么他们也可以对这个文件或目录进行写操作。

这种权限继承机制可以通过文件系统的挂载选项和文件属性来实现。例如,使用chmod命令可以更改文件或目录的权限,而使用chown命令可以更改文件或目录的所有者和所属组。此外,还可以使用chattr命令来更改文件或目录的扩展属性,例如设置或更改文件的不可修改(immutable)属性。

总之,Linux的write操作权限继承机制是基于用户、组和其他用户的权限设置,通过文件系统的挂载选项和文件属性来实现。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/74465.html

相关推荐

  • BundleLinux与其它Linux发行版相比有何优势

    BundleLinux与其它Linux发行版相比有何优势

    BundleLinux是一个基于Flatpak的Linux发行版,它的优势包括: 应用程序打包管理:BundleLinux采用Flatpak打包应用程序,使得用户可以很方便地安装、更新和卸载应...

  • 如何在BundleLinux上配置网络连接

    如何在BundleLinux上配置网络连接

    在BundleLinux上配置网络连接可以通过以下步骤实现: 打开终端,输入以下命令查看网络接口信息:
    ifconfig 确定网络接口的名称,通常以”eth”或”wlan”开...

  • Linux中dlsym函数的错误处理方式

    Linux中dlsym函数的错误处理方式

    在Linux中,dlsym函数用于在动态链接库中查找符号并返回其地址。如果dlsym函数在查找符号时遇到错误,通常会返回NULL,并可以通过调用dlerror函数来获取错误信息...

  • 如何通过dlsym获取Linux动态库中的函数指针

    如何通过dlsym获取Linux动态库中的函数指针

    要通过dlsym获取Linux动态库中的函数指针,可以按照以下步骤进行: 打开动态库:首先使用dlopen函数打开动态库,示例代码如下:
    void *handle = dlopen("li...

  • Actran Linux安装部署常见问题

    Actran Linux安装部署常见问题

    Actran是一款在Linux环境下运行的仿真软件,用于流体动力学、热传递和结构力学等领域的模拟分析。在安装和部署Actran时,可能会遇到一些常见问题。以下是一些建议...

  • Linux的media数据处理流程优化建议

    Linux的media数据处理流程优化建议

    在Linux系统中,处理媒体数据(如音频、视频)通常涉及多个组件和步骤,包括输入/输出设备、编解码器、滤镜、渲染应用等。优化这些组件和步骤可以提高媒体数据处...

  • Ctag Linux官方文档更新及时吗

    Ctag Linux官方文档更新及时吗

    ctags 是一个用于生成 C 语言及其他编程语言代码的快速、可移植的索引的工具。关于 Linux 官方文档的更新及时性,这通常取决于你所指的特定文档或资源。 Linux 内...

  • Linux的write操作权限设置技巧

    Linux的write操作权限设置技巧

    在Linux中,文件或目录的权限设置对于保护系统安全和用户数据非常重要 了解权限概念:Linux中的权限分为三类:所有者权限(u)、组权限(g)和其他用户权限(o)...